To begin understanding the brain's building blocks, let's start with the basics. The human brain consists of approximately 86 billion neurons, intricately connected to form a vast network of ηλεκtrical impulses and chemical signals. These neurons, or nerve cells, are the brain's primary building blocks, responsible for processing and transmitting information. Each neuron consists of three main parts:
